Preparation time: 30 minutes
Cooling time: 2 hours (total)
Number of servings: 12

Ingredients

For the dessert:
- 2 store-bought sponge cake layers

For glaze 1:
- 120 g cocoa chocolate
- 70 g butter
- 1 tablespoon cold-pressed mint syrup (can be replaced with water)
- 2 tablespoons oil

For glaze 2:
- 180 g cocoa chocolate
- 80 g butter
- 2 tablespoons mint syrup
- 2 tablespoons oil

For the cream:
- 500 ml liquid cream "El Maestro"
- 2 packets of cream stabilizer
- 2 tablespoons milk
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 3 tablespoons powdered sugar
- 4 packets of vanilla sugar Dr. Oetker

Step by Step: Preparing the Kinder Pingui Dessert

Step 1: Preparing the first glaze
We start with preparing the first glaze, which will add a delicious layer of chocolate. In a small saucepan, place the cocoa chocolate, butter, mint syrup, and oil. Place the saucepan over low heat and stir continuously. It is essential to be patient, as the chocolate will gradually melt, and constant stirring will prevent burning. Once the chocolate has completely melted and the mixture becomes homogeneous, remove the saucepan from the heat and set it aside.

Step 2: Preparing the cream
In a large bowl, add the liquid cream. It is important to use a quality cream, as this will influence the final texture of the cream. Add the stabilizer, vanilla sugar, powdered sugar, milk, and honey. Using a mixer, start at a low speed to avoid splattering. After a minute, increase the speed to maximum. Whip until you achieve a firm cream that can be easily spread over the sponge cake.

Step 3: Assembling the dessert
On a wooden board, place the first layer of sponge cake. This will serve as the base for the dessert. Pour half of the cream over the sponge cake and level it evenly. Then, add the first layer of glaze on top of the cream, ensuring it is evenly distributed. Now, it’s time to let the dessert cool in the refrigerator for about 15-20 minutes, so the glaze can set slightly.

Step 4: Continuing the assembly
After the first glaze has set, remove the dessert from the refrigerator and spread the remaining glaze. Let it cool again. Meanwhile, prepare the second glaze using the same method as for the first, but with the corresponding ingredients.

Step 5: Finalizing the dessert
Remove the dessert from the refrigerator and spread the remaining cream, then add the second layer of sponge cake, pressing gently to adhere. Glaze the dessert with the second glaze, repeating the cooling process between layers. You can create decorative shapes with a fork for an elegant appearance.

To serve:
When you want to cut a slice of cake, make sure to use a very sharp knife, which you should dip in warm water. This will help achieve clean and beautiful slices. The Kinder Pingui dessert is particularly delicious and will surely be appreciated by everyone, especially the little ones.

Practical Tips for a Perfect Result

- Choosing ingredients: Use high-quality chocolate for a more intense flavor. Chocolate with a higher cocoa content will add richness to the dessert.
- Cooling: Be patient with the cooling time. Each layer of glaze must be well set before adding the next; otherwise, they may mix and blur.
- Customization: You can add additional ingredients to the cream, such as vanilla essence or a splash of rum, to give it a distinct flavor.

Possible Variations

- Alternative glazes: Instead of mint, you can use orange or caramel syrup to customize the dessert to your tastes.
- Dairy-free options: If you want a vegan version, you can use coconut cream and vegan dark chocolate.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I use homemade sponge cake layers?
Sure! Homemade sponge cake layers can add extra flavor and freshness.

2. How long can the dessert be kept?
Kinder Pingui keeps well in the refrigerator for 3-4 days, but it will be best in the first 2 days.

3. What drinks pair well with Kinder Pingui?
A cup of black coffee or a mint-flavored tea will perfectly complement the sweetness of the dessert. Also, a glass of cold milk is always a good choice.
